Cabinet demolition services involve carefully removing existing cabinets from kitchens, bathrooms, or other areas within a property. This process typically includes disconnecting plumbing, electrical fixtures, and securing the surrounding structures to prevent damage.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and techniques to efficiently dismantle cabinets while minimizing disruption to the rest of the space. This service is essential when planning a renovation, remodeling, or updating a room’s layout, ensuring the old cabinetry is safely and cleanly removed before new installations begin.

The overview below groups typical Cabinet Demolition proj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Edison, NJ.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or cabinet demolition projects, such as removing a few cabinets or replacing doors, usually range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the size and complexity. Fewer projects will push into the higher end of this spectrum.
Partial Demolition - For larger projects involving partial removal of cabinets or kitchen upgrades, local contractors often charge between $600-$2,000. This range covers most mid-sized jobs, with larger, more complex projects reaching higher costs.
Full Kitchen Replacement - Complete cabinet removal and replacement typically cost between $2,000-$5,000, depending on the size of the space and materials used. Many full replacements fall into this range, though very extensive renovations can cost more.
Complex or Custom Projects - Larger, more intricate demolition jobs, such as those involving structural modifications or custom cabinetry, can exceed $5,000. These projects are less common and usually require specialized services from local pros, with costs varying based on scope and details.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is involved in cabinet demolition? Cabinet demolition typically includes removing cabinets, hardware, and any attached components, preparing the area for renovation or remodeling projects.
Are there different types of cabinet demolition services? Yes, services can range from partial removal, such as removing upper or lower cabinets, to complete demolition of all cabinetry in a space.
What should I consider before hiring a cabinet demolition contractor? It's important to verify that local contractors have experience with similar projects and can safely handle the removal process without damaging surrounding areas.
Can cabinet demolition be combined with other renovation services? Yes, cabinet removal often accompanies kitchen or bathroom remodels, allowing for a streamlined renovation process handled by local service providers.
How do local contractors dispose of old cabinets? Most service providers will handle the proper disposal or recycling of the removed cabinets as part of their demolition service.
